    “Win or Get Sacked!” Ebonyi Gov Nwifuru Threatens Council Chairmen Ahead of 2027 Election

    Gov. Francis Nwifuru of Ebonyi has threatened to remove any local government council chairman who fails to deliver his council to the All Progressives Congress (APC) in the 2027 general elections.

    Nwifuru issued the warning on Tuesday in Abakaliki while inaugurating the newly elected chairmen and vice chairmen of the 13 local government areas in the state.

    The governor said any council chairman who failed to deliver his council to the APC would be removed from office and replaced with a councillor.

    “Any chairman who fails to win his council will be removed from office and replaced with a councillor.

    “I want this information to be on the headlines of newspapers because, as politicians, we would not speak in secret,” he said.

    Nwifuru said the chairmen were expected to ensure victory for the APC in their respective councils in the 2027 elections.

    He urged them not to allow opposition political parties to gain ground in their areas, saying that “charity begins from home.”

    The governor charged the chairmen to do everything within their powers to deliver the APC 100 per cent in the 2027 elections.

    He also urged the vice chairmen to work closely with their chairmen and avoid rivalry.

    Nwifuru likened the positions of the vice chairmen to “spare tyres inside the car boot”, saying they should remain available to support their chairmen.

    “You should always be available to the chairmen and ask them of your councils’ daily activities.

    “Do not listen to gossip and ill advice from your friends against your chairmen because that will destroy your relationship with them,” he said.

    The governor cited his deputy as an example, noting that she had previously served as a council chairman before becoming deputy governor.

    “She performed in ways people saw her and believed she could do the work of a deputy governor.

    “My deputy is doing the work perfectly and presently enjoying the position,” he said.
